Transaction 204985744cf1267f2e42240a310799eb40eecd42015c8016f44e1598d7cba5ff
1 Input
2 Outputs
- 204985744cf1267f2e42240a310799eb40eecd42015c8016f44e1598d7cba5ff:0
- 204985744cf1267f2e42240a310799eb40eecd42015c8016f44e1598d7cba5ff:1
value 5706003485
address 1H8hA6uhj1ACXKEjbiZs2EggdRRjXHfF54
value 267397860
address 1KY2V2tbRQeFwpPwwiKJpAkRAorGiNUAL4